Facts of the Case

Background

The applicant, a truck driver employed by the second respondent, was dismissed in September 2012 after a disciplinary hearing. He appealed to the National Employment Council for the Transport Operating Industry (NECTOI) but received no response. When he approached a labour officer in January 2013, the officer found he had no jurisdiction and issued a certificate of settlement. The applicant then brought this application under section 93(7) of the Labour Act seeking to compel NECTOI to issue a certificate of no settlement.
